Output 67c61bfaebcce5306ec8ed95e94018637c9119ba190eccb06bed8a19958ab302:1

value
65623
script pubkey
OP_0 OP_PUSHBYTES_20 12d3bc4fea28319731357299d7c034e9b4efc4c1
address
bc1qztfmcnl29qcewvf4w2va0sp5ax6wl3xp49ehds
transaction
67c61bfaebcce5306ec8ed95e94018637c9119ba190eccb06bed8a19958ab302
spent
true